aight heres the deal the f23a1 is the vtec and so is the f23a4 although the f23a4 is the ulev(ultra low emissions vehicle) thats also what i got in my car

the f23a1 has 150 hp and the f23a4 has 148 not much a difference thank god

F23a1 and F23a4 are identical save for the exhaust manifold. THe a4 manifold holds in more heat and back pressure (This helps out the cat). Swap for an aftermarket header or pickup an a1 manifold online and your set to go with getting back your 2hp
